首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Splunk学习与实践

Data Routing Cloningand and Load Balancing:数据复制与负载均衡, Index:顾名思义,它跟索引有关,实际上他不仅仅负责为数据建立索引,还负责响应查找索引数据的用户请求...虽然indexer可以在查找它本身的数据,但是,在多indexer的集群中,可以通过叫“search head”的组件来整合多个indexer,对外提供统一的查询管理和服务。...索引器将原始数据转换为事件并将事件存储至索引(Index)中。索引器还搜索索引数据,以响应搜索请求。...搜索节点:在分布式搜索环境中,搜索节点是建立索引并完成源自搜索头搜索请求的Splunk Enterprise实例。.../splunk add index linux_audit 2、在splunkforwarder服务器上添加一个监控项 .

4.6K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    【NCRE四级网络工程师】计算机网络单选题

    每个物理网络都有自己的MTU,MTU主要规定:一个帧最多能够携带的数据量 在客户机/服务器模型中,服务器响应客户机的请求有两种实现方案,它们是并发服务器方案和(重复服务器)。...关于即时通信系统的描述中,正确的是(RFC2778规定了其通讯模型)。 即时通信IM是一种基于Internet的通信服务,由以色列Mirabils公司最早提出,它提供近实时的信息交换和用户状态跟踪。...即时通信系统通常需要支持两种基本的服务,它们是:呈现服务和即时消息服务 关于P2P文件共享系统的描述中,错误的是(A)。...由于通信双方加密与解密使用同一个密钥,所以密钥在加密方和解密方之间的传递和分发必须通过安全通道进行。...关于MD5的描述中,错误的是()。

    87510

    一文搞明白SAD DNS(Side channel Attacked DNS) CVE-2020-25705

    : 第一阶段,攻击者尝试使用DHCP策略获取240个IP地址 第二阶段,重复以下操作,攻击者向转发器发出查询,要求提供任意子域,例如nonce.attacker.com....在发现一个端口打开后,我们通过重复探测同一个端口来确认它至少保持打开一秒钟。...如果有,我们就开始注入伪造响应 实验重复20次,报告成功率、平均成功时间等统计数据 结果: 在20个实验中成功率为100%(如果攻击在30分钟内完成,我们认为是成功的) 平均成功时间为271s,第一阶段为...在50%的静音水平下,20例中只有9例成功,平均耗时为8985秒或2.5小时。...注意,altered实验中的扫描速度高于baseline实验中的扫描速度。这是因为我们在altered实验中使用了两个IP,减少了扫描过程中中断的频率。

    2K10

    所以你是因此而想使用区块链么?

    事实上,区块链是将数据复制到所有相关参与者的机制 - 这就是共识。...但考虑到工业间谍的威胁,其中密钥出售给同时运行节点的竞争组织 - 现在竞争对手可以在没有侵入系统的情况下读取数据,因为区块链正在将数据复制到他的数据中心!...事实上,区块链上的数据默认是不加密的,特别是需要由节点验证的数据。在比特币中,交易数据没有加密,正如您通过查看比特币区块链中的任何交易所看到的。有关比特币交易中特定元素的更深入的解释,请参阅此处。...在私有链中,如果所有验证节点都可以通过解密密钥来解密数据,那么您首先需要考虑为什么要对其进行加密。...主题:区块链将是所有事件的不可变记录 在比特币中,需要跟踪旧交易以便找出新交易的有效性,情况就是这样。同样的情况是,比特币交易只会“发生”,或者如果它被广播到比特币网络并被接受为一个区块,就会结算。

    81880

    如何在Ubuntu 16.04上使用Git Hooks部署Jekyll站点

    在本教程中,我们将配置一个生产环境以使用Nginx来托管Jekyll站点,以及Git在您将更改推送到站点存储库时跟踪更改并重新生成站点。...首先,从/var/www/html目录中删除默认网页: $ sudo rm /var/www/html/index.nginx-debian.html 现在,将目录的所有权设置为git用户,以便此用户可以在收到更改时更新站点的内容...该组确保Web服务器可以访问和管理位于/var/www/html位置的文件: $ sudo chown git:www-data /var/www/html 在继续本教程之前,将SSH密钥复制到新创建的...最简单的方法是使用该ssh-copy-id命令,但您也可以手动复制密钥。 现在让我们为您的Jekyll站点创建一个Git存储库,然后配置Git hooks以在更新时重建它。...如果您发现任何错误,请确保在继续教程之前解决它们。

    1.3K30

    网络原理知识总结

    需解决数据中出现SOH和EOH时的转义。方法是在之前加入一个转义字符,如ESC。差错校验通信链路可能出现比特差错。误码率EBR:错误比特数/总传输比特数。...总线型共享信道,存在碰撞需采用CSMA/CD协议(载波监听多点接入/碰撞检测)多点接入:多个计算机多点接入一根总线上。载波监听:在发送数据前先监听信道是否空闲。...用于在 IP 网络中传递控制消息,诊断网络连接问题、跟踪路由路径等。ping 和 traceroute 命令采用 ICMP 协议。路由器至少连接两个网络,才能起到转发作用。...端口分类:公认端口:0~1023,如 http 80,https 443,ssh 22 等注册端口:1024~49151,需在机构登记防止冲突。...4XX,客户端错误,404为找不到资源。5XX,服务器错误,500为服务器内部错误。响应头字段Age:在缓存代理服务中驻留的时长,单位秒。Content-Length:内容长度,只有持久连接时才有效。

    36333

    ng 核心模块

    这个iterator函数执行基于iterator(value,key,obj)结构的函数,value是一个对象的属性或者是数组的元素,key是对象的key或者是数组中的index,或者是obj自己。...angular.extend 扩展目标对象dst,使用从src对象复制可枚举属性到dst。我可以指定多个src对象。...使用Angular标记类似于{{hash}}在一个href属性中,如果点击的时机早于Angular替换{{hash}}标记将导致连接到错误的URL。...使用Angular 标记例如{{hash}}在一个src属性中不能正确工作:浏览器将从带有{{hash}}的URL中获取资源直到Angular替换了这个表达式。使用ngSrc指令可以解决这个问题。...使用Angular 标记例如{{hash}}在一个srcset属性中不能正确工作:浏览器将从带有{{hash}}的URL中获取资源直到Angular替换了这个表达式。

    1.2K10

    RabbitMq 技术文档

    当生产者收不到confirm时,消息可能会重复,所以如果消息不允许重复,则消费者需要自己实现消息去重。...例如,我们可以仅仅将致命的错误写入日志文件,然而仍然在控制面板上打印出所有的其他类型的日志消息。 5.4.1 绑定(Bindings) 在前面的例子中我们已经使用过绑定。...例如:我们可能希望把致命类型的错误写入硬盘,而不把硬盘空间浪费在警告或者消息类型的日志上。之前我们使用fanout类型的转发器,但是并没有给我们带来更多的灵活性:仅仅可以愚蠢的转发。...为了在我们的系统中实现上述的需求,我们需要学习稍微复杂的主题类型的转发器(topic exchange)。...在设计方案时就应该考虑到。队列只有在保持队列中不积压消息时,性能才是最佳的,队列中积压的消息越多,性能下降越多。

    2.5K11

    MySQL 8.0 与 8.4 主主同步

    在主主同步中,主节点间的复制延迟和冲突解决有了显著优化,减少了复制中的性能瓶颈。 改进的 GTID 复制: 在 MySQL 8.4 中,GTID(全局事务标识符)机制进一步优化。...GTID 复制使得跨多个节点的数据同步和事务追踪变得更加可靠。 GTID 的自动生成和追踪更加精准,能够有效避免主主同步中因事务丢失或重复提交而产生的数据不一致问题。...8.4 中对半同步复制的改进,使得主主同步的环境在高可用性场景下表现更加稳定。...错误日志增强: 在 MySQL 8.4 中,复制错误日志被增强,能够更好地诊断同步延迟、复制错误及事务冲突等问题,这对于维护主主同步的健康状态至关重要。 2....数据一致性和容错 一致性保证:MySQL 8.4 提供更强的数据一致性保证,特别是在使用 GTID 模式时,能够确保各个节点的数据一致性。在主主同步架构中,确保没有数据丢失和数据重复是至关重要的。

    24110

    讲解CUDA error: an illegal memory access was encountered

    通常可以通过查看错误的堆栈跟踪信息来定位问题的源头。堆栈跟踪信息中会指示出错误出现的具体代码行数和函数,从而帮助我们进行排查。...最后,将处理后的图像数据从 GPU 内存中复制回主机内存,并显示处理后的图像。cuda-memcheck是一个CUDA官方提供的用于内存错误检测和分析的工具。...它能够帮助开发者在CUDA应用程序中发现和调试内存访问错误,如越界访问、未初始化内存访问、重复释放内存等。...它能够检测到应用程序中的潜在问题,并提供详细的错误报告,包括错误类型、错误位置和堆栈跟踪信息,帮助开发者快速定位和解决问题。...以下是cuda-memcheck的一些主要特性:内存错误检测:cuda-memcheck能够检测CUDA应用程序中的内存错误,包括越界访问、未初始化内存读写、重复释放内存等。

    4K10

    公共云中数据保护的6个步骤

    密钥管理至关重要,而让管理员拥有密钥相当于等待一场灾难的发生,而工作人员在便条上写下密码更是一种极端。云计算提供商提供的一种选择是基于驱动器的加密,但是这种方式失败了。...另外,在虚拟机中,临时本地实例驱动器也可以让数据曝光泄露。例如,如果实例崩溃,工作人员是否知道数据会发生什么变化?如果找不到它,但服务器可能已经死机,可以采用自己的可移动驱动器(例如加密密钥)。...重复数据删除最终会得到任何给定对象的适当保护的单个副本。对该对象的所有其他用途或引用只是元数据文件中的指针。 重复数据删除有两件事:它节省了驱动器空间,并简化了管理。...简化管理实际上更重要,尤其是在人们将分析和索引工具添加到存储系统时。任何花费时间搜索具有相同名称的文件目录的管理员都需要了解这个价值主张。 复制管理也允许数据得到充分保护。...·限制知道密钥的管理员人数 ·在源处加密,因此黑客嗅探传输数据包将会失败 ·不要使用基于驱动器的加密,因为大多数驱动器都可以在网络上使用(短)密钥列表。

    68970

    批量管理自动化运维100台小规模服务器

    ,在日常的管理中经常会遇到重复性的动作,如更新备上百台服务器上的ssh公钥、备份上百台服务器上的/etc/passwd配置文件等等,通常情况下采用专用自动化运维工具assibe,若因资源或技术因素没有安装此类服务...,此时可以通过脚本实现小规模服务器集群的自动化运维,记住只要是重复3次以上的动作,在自动化运维的时代里必须采用自动化手法进行运维管理。...,具体原理见如下: ssh-keygen命令用来生成公钥和私钥密钥对的工具,通常用法如下 命令选项含义ssh-keygen-t指定创建的密钥对的加密算法,默认为rsa-p输入旧的密码,在新建密钥对时不加此选项...Enter passphrase (empty for no passphrase): #如若选择给私钥加口令,则在每次使用时,提供口令 Enter same passphrase again: 时,在使用时需输入口令...-e指定错误输出目录-l指定以某用户的方式登录等价于user@host1中的user-AKey的认证基于用户,如若没有对某些用户认证key,但是要批量操作加用此选项表示启用密码登录认证[root@centos7

    5.4K150

    2018-09-10 MariaDB和MySQL全面对比:选择数据库需要考虑这几点

    密钥管理——MariaDB提供开箱即用的AWS密钥管理插件。MySQL也提供了一些用于密钥管理的插件,但它们仅在企业版中可用。...在MySQL的社区版本中,线程数是固定的,因而限制了这种灵活性。MySQL计划在企业版中增加线程池功能。 性能 近年来,出现了很多关于MySQL和MariaDB引擎性能的基准测试。...以下是这两个数据库在复制配置方面的一些差别: MySQL的默认二进制日志格式是基于行的,而在MariaDB中,默认的二进制日志格式是混合式的。...从好的方面来说,用户可以更及时地收到功能和错误修复。从不好的方面来说,为了让MariaDB保持最新的状态,需要更多的工作量。...此外,任何人都可以向MariaDB提交补丁,MariaDB开发团队会考虑将这些补丁添加到主代码库中。因此,从某种程度上说,MariaDB是由社区开发的,而MySQL主要由甲骨文开发。

    2.2K30

    源码分析 RocketMQ DLedger(多副本) 之日志追加流程

    1、日志复制基本流程 ---- 在正式分析 RocketMQ DLedger 多副本复制之前,我们首先来了解客户端发送日志的请求协议字段,其类图如下所示: ?...代码@1:如果 dLedgerEntryPusher 的 push 队列已满,则返回追加一次,其错误码为 LEADER_PENDING_FULL。...1.2 Leader 节点存储数据 Leader 节点的数据存储主要由 DLedgerStore 的 appendAsLeader 方法实现。...代码@3:如果 peerWaterMarksByTerm 存储的 index 小于当前数据的 index,则更新。...在进入下一篇的文章学习之前,我们不妨思考一下如下问题: 如果主节点追加成功(写入到 PageCache),但同步到从节点过程失败或此时主节点宕机,集群中的数据如何保证一致性?

    56620

    MariaDB和MySQL全面对比:选择数据库需要考虑这几点

    密钥管理——MariaDB提供开箱即用的AWS密钥管理插件。MySQL也提供了一些用于密钥管理的插件,但它们仅在企业版中可用。...在MySQL的社区版本中,线程数是固定的,因而限制了这种灵活性。MySQL计划在企业版中增加线程池功能。 性能 近年来,出现了很多关于MySQL和MariaDB引擎性能的基准测试。...以下是这两个数据库在复制配置方面的一些差别: MySQL的默认二进制日志格式是基于行的,而在MariaDB中,默认的二进制日志格式是混合式的。...从好的方面来说,用户可以更及时地收到功能和错误修复。从不好的方面来说,为了让MariaDB保持最新的状态,需要更多的工作量。...此外,任何人都可以向MariaDB提交补丁,MariaDB开发团队会考虑将这些补丁添加到主代码库中。因此,从某种程度上说,MariaDB是由社区开发的,而MySQL主要由甲骨文开发。

    2.9K10

    Apache Kafka元素解析

    在Apache Kafka生态中,事件,是一个具有键,值,时间戳和可选的元数据标题。密钥不仅用于标识,而且还用于具有相同密钥的事件的路由和聚合操作。...它们在事件驱动的体系结构中扮演着主要角色。 3、键事件:具有键但与任何业务实体都不相关的事件。该密钥用于聚合和分区。...当消费者将处理带有错误的东西并想再次对其进行处理时,这也解决了一个问题。主题始终可以有零个,一个或多个生产者和订阅者。...它将每个 Partition 分为多个 Segment,每个 Segment 对应两个文件:“.index” 索引文件和 “.log” 数据文件。...复制基于领导者跟踪方法。 以上为Apache Kafka体系中的基本元素的简要解析,只有将基础的概念梳理清楚,才能在后续的架构实践中容易上手,以便能够解决项目中的问题。

    71520

    『学习笔记』Nginx配置文件的模块化与结构优化指南

    文章详细阐述了在Linux系统上安装、配置OpenVPN服务器和客户端,以及IPsec的配置和管理步骤,包括证书和密钥的生成。通过这些步骤,可以提高数据传输的安全性和网络的可靠性。...例如,在某电商平台中,Nginx的配置文件需要同时处理静态资源的分发、反向代理、负载均衡、安全策略等多个功能。如果这些配置全部集中在一个大文件中,随着功能的增加,配置文件会变得冗长且难以维护。...可重用性(Reusability)将常用配置提取到独立模块中,便于在不同的Nginx实例中重用。例如,可以为每个项目创建独立的SSL模块,或为多个服务创建通用的反向代理配置模块。...在项目初期,单个配置文件可能足够,但随着需求增加,配置文件的长度和复杂度也显著提升,导致以下问题:可读性差:难以快速理解和修改配置。易出错:重复配置和冗余代码易引发问题。.../ { try_files $uri $uri/ =404; }}优化前后的对比优化前的问题原始配置文件集中在一个文件中,包含多个虚拟主机和大量重复代码:server { listen

    17010

    PG 13新特性汇总

    ,如果需要对分区表进行逻辑复制,需单独对所有分区进行逻辑复制。...在PostgreSQL13中,分区的主表可以在源PostgreSQL13中直接publish,这样会将该主表下的所有分区自动的进行publish在PostgreSQL12中,主表无法被create publication...Deduplication 会定期的将重复的索引项合并,为每组形成一个发布列表元组,重复的索引项在此列表中仅出现一次,当表的索引键重复项很多时,能显著减少索引的存储空间。...你可以在pg_replication_slots中查看复制槽有效的WAL。 总结: 默认值是-1,-1表示表示禁用本功能。单位是MB。...该行为要优于之前的行为,在之前的版本中,一旦选择了hash aggregation,无论hash table有多大,hash table都将保留在内存中--如果planner估计错误,它可能会很大。

    1.3K10
    领券